Ask Your Question

build error, non-resolvable parent POM

asked 2016-03-30 22:27:28 -0700

kimguji gravatar image

updated 2016-03-30 22:29:19 -0700

I tried to build from source 'controller' and 'integration'. Controller was successfully built, but I could not build 'integration' project. I downloaded lithium stable version.

git clone -b stable/lithium

And tried to install in integration folder.

mvn clean install -D skipTests

I got this error.

[ERROR] [ERROR] Some problems were encountered while processing the POMs: [FATAL] Non-resolvable parent POM for org.opendaylight.integration:root:0.3.2-SNAPSHOT: Failure to find org.opendaylight.odlparent:odlparent:pom:1.5.2-SNAPSHOT in was cached in the local repository, resolution will not be reattempted until the update interval of opendaylight-snapshot has elapsed or updates are forced and 'parent.relativePath' points at no local POM @ line 3, column 11

I already changed my ~/.m2/settings.xml as instruction. I tried other versions, and got similar errors.

URL specified in settings.xml, '' does not have odlparent 1.5.2-SNAPSHOT. It has 1.5.2-Lithium-SR2, 1.5.0-Lithium, 1.5.5-SNAPSHOT.

I'm a newbie in OpenDaylight and this makes me confused.

edit retag flag offensive close merge delete

1 answer

Sort by ยป oldest newest most voted

answered 2016-03-31 02:06:14 -0700

bhavesh07 gravatar image

Try with the new settings.xml by executing the below command :

curl --create-dirs -o ~/.m2/settings.xml

While build, to skip test cases execute the below command :

mvn clean install -DskipTests

where "-DskipTests" is a single parameter.

edit flag offensive delete publish link more


Thanks for your comment, but I already set ~/.m2/settings.xml as wiki explained. I did same work to helium version and it was successful. I checked odlparent version in POM file in source code, but some of the specified versions do not exist in

kimguji ( 2016-03-31 02:29:16 -0700 )edit

Which version of OpenDaylight do you use? I also tried beryllium version and it generates same error.

kimguji ( 2016-03-31 02:29:43 -0700 )edit

I work with stable beryllium, it is working fine.

bhavesh07 ( 2016-04-04 22:03:58 -0700 )edit

It is working fine too. I downloaded and checkout lithium-SR1, and it was fine. Lithium and Beryllium(controller) both are okay. Thanks for your answer.

kimguji ( 2016-04-07 03:26:14 -0700 )edit

@kimguji If this answer is working fine then Please mark it as correct answer so that it'll be helpful for others as well.

bhavesh07 ( 2016-04-10 21:42:50 -0700 )edit

Your Answer

Please start posting anonymously - your entry will be published after you log in or create a new account.

Add Answer

[hide preview]


Asked: 2016-03-30 22:27:28 -0700

Seen: 441 times

Last updated: Mar 31 '16